Inhale Capital provides 100% funding for Hale chapel acquisition
By Bridging Loan Directory

Inhale Capital has completed a fully funded acquisition facility for a Welsh Presbyterian Chapel in Hale, Cheshire.
The 1,628 sq ft red-brick chapel, located close to Hale and Altrincham town centres, was acquired using additional security over an unencumbered residential property in Hale, enabling Inhale Capital to provide 100% funding without requiring formal valuations on either asset.
The structure allowed the lender to issue funding certainty within two hours of the transaction being introduced by the broker.
Inhale Capital said the borrower’s experience, combined with a clearly defined business plan and additional security support, enabled the transaction to proceed quickly despite the specialist nature of the asset.
Rob Goodall, CEO of Inhale Capital, said:
“We were working with an experienced borrower who had a clear plan for the asset, and the additional security structure allowed us to move quickly without the delays often associated with formal valuations.
It’s a good example of how specialist lenders can structure around transactions that may fall outside conventional lending parameters.”
